- 😀 Oil was used historically in ancient civilizations for purposes like lighting, waterproofing, and construction, but it became commercially important around 1850.
- 😀 Oil forms from the remains of organic materials buried under sediments, where heat and pressure convert it into hydrocarbons in sedimentary rocks.
- 😀 The fractional distillation process in refineries separates oil into various components, such as gasoline, diesel, and lubricants, based on their boiling points.
- 😀 Oil is a non-renewable resource, meaning once extracted, it cannot be replaced, making it a significant issue for global energy dependence.
- 😀 Over 60% of global energy production is still reliant on oil, making its geopolitical and economic importance crucial in today's world.
- 😀 The classification of hydrocarbons derived from oil includes alkanes, alkenes, alkynes, alkadienes, cyclanes, and aromatics, with specific naming rules for each.
- 😀 The geopolitical importance of oil is highlighted, with countries vying for control over oil reserves for economic and strategic advantages.
- 😀 The OPEC organization plays a key role in regulating oil prices and production, aiming to maintain economic stability for oil-exporting countries.
- 😀 Despite the focus on the Middle East, significant oil reserves are located in various regions globally, which are key to the international energy market.

What is the significance of oil historically and how was it used in ancient times?
-Historically, oil was used for various purposes such as lighting in ancient Egypt, waterproofing homes, embalming mummies, and as a mortar in construction, particularly in the Middle East for building Babylon and the Wall of Jericho.
When did oil become commercially important, and who was responsible for its early processing?
-Oil became commercially important around 1850 when the first American chemist developed a process to obtain oil and started the first oil processing plant.
What is the process of oil formation, and how is it related to geography?
-Oil is formed through the decomposition of organic materials buried under high pressure and absence of oxygen, in sedimentary rock layers. The process of oil formation is closely linked to the physical processes of Earth's formation, which is a topic covered in geography.
What is fractional distillation, and how is it applied in the oil industry?
-Fractional distillation is a process where oil is separated into different hydrocarbons based on their boiling points. In oil refineries, this process helps obtain different products, such as gasoline, kerosene, and diesel, from crude oil.
What is petroleum cracking, and why is it important in the oil industry?
-Petroleum cracking is a process used to break down large, complex hydrocarbons into smaller, more useful molecules. This process increases the efficiency of oil usage and is essential for producing a variety of petroleum products.
What are hydrocarbons, and how are they classified?
-Hydrocarbons are compounds made up of only carbon and hydrogen atoms. They are classified into different types based on their molecular structure: alkanes (single bonds), alkenes (double bonds), alkynes (triple bonds), alkadienes, cyclanes, and aromatics.
What is the role of oil in global energy production, and why is it considered a non-renewable resource?
-Oil plays a crucial role in global energy production, providing more than 60% of the world's energy needs. It is considered a non-renewable resource because it cannot be replenished once extracted, making it unsustainable in the long run.
How does oil affect geopolitical relations and global conflicts?
-Oil plays a significant role in geopolitics, as nations vie for control over oil reserves. The control of oil resources often leads to economic and political power struggles, with countries seeking to secure access to these valuable resources.
What is OPEC, and how does it influence the global oil market?
-OPEC (Organization of the Petroleum Exporting Countries) is a group of oil-exporting nations that work together to regulate the price of oil. The organization was created in response to the dominance of oil cartels and continues to influence global oil prices today.
